Career path
| Career Role (Online Moderation) | Description |
|---|---|
| Senior Online Community Manager | Develops and implements online moderation policies; manages community guidelines; high-level strategic planning. Strong leadership skills are essential. |
| Social Media Moderator (Policy Enforcement) | Monitors social media platforms for policy violations; removes inappropriate content; responds to user queries; ensures brand safety. Daily moderation tasks. |
| Content Moderator (Gaming/E-commerce) | Reviews user-generated content in online games or e-commerce platforms; ensures compliance with platform policies. Requires detailed understanding of platform-specific rules. |
| Online Safety Officer (Child Protection) | Focuses on identifying and reporting child exploitation and abuse; works with law enforcement; highly sensitive and crucial role in online safety. Requires strong ethical awareness. |
